Publisher Superhot Presents and independent Slovak studio straka.studio have released their pixel roguelike action game Loot River with procedurally generated dungeons.

To mark the release, the developers presented a new trailer that shows the variety of Loot River locations and methods of moving around them.
In terms of gameplay, the new project by straka.studio combines intense real-time battles in a dark fantasy setting with block movement mechanics.
The authors themselves position Loot River as a hybrid of Dark Souls and Tetris, additionally equipped with a rich combat system. Separately, you can highlight the variability of enemies and 26 types of weapons with unique attacks.
Loot River is now available on PCsteam), Xbox One, Xbox Series X and S. The project is also available on Game Pass. At the time of publishing the material, Loot River has accumulated 53 user reviews on Steam, 71% of which are positive.
The first players praise the project for expressive pixel graphics, an interesting idea with the movement of the protagonist and a large number of local puzzles.
Here is the combat system “broken hitboxes” and the inability to parry or dodge at the right time, as well as general glitches when playing animations were the main reasons for dissatisfaction.
